tomcat修改内存配置(tomcat8修改内存大小)
简介:
Tomcat是一个常用的Java Web服务器,用于托管和运行Java Web应用程序。在某些情况下,我们可能需要修改Tomcat的内存配置,以优化服务器的性能和稳定性。本文将介绍如何修改Tomcat的内存配置。
多级标题:
一、了解Tomcat的内存配置
二、备份Tomcat的配置文件
三、修改Tomcat的内存配置
3.1 修改启动脚本
3.2 修改Tomcat配置文件
四、重启Tomcat服务器
五、验证内存配置的修改
内容详细说明:
一、了解Tomcat的内存配置:
在开始修改Tomcat的内存配置之前,我们需要先了解一些关于Tomcat内存的基本概念。Tomcat使用Java虚拟机(JVM)来执行Java代码,而JVM通过Java堆来存储对象。在Tomcat的内存配置中,我们主要关注Java堆的大小和JVM的初始内存和最大内存大小。
二、备份Tomcat的配置文件:
在修改Tomcat的内存配置之前,强烈建议先备份Tomcat的配置文件,以防止配置文件损坏。
三、修改Tomcat的内存配置:
3.1 修改启动脚本:
打开Tomcat的启动脚本(如startup.sh或startup.bat),找到设置JVM参数的地方。在这个地方,可以设置JVM的初始内存和最大内存大小。
3.2 修改Tomcat配置文件:
在Tomcat的安装目录下找到conf文件夹,打开catalina.sh(Linux)或catalina.bat(Windows)文件。将以下行添加到文件的适当位置:
CATALINA_OPTS="-Xms512m -Xmx1024m"
这将把JVM的初始内存设置为512MB,最大内存设置为1024MB。
四、重启Tomcat服务器:
保存修改后的配置文件,并重启Tomcat服务器,以使修改生效。
五、验证内存配置的修改:
可以通过查看Tomcat的日志文件来验证内存配置的修改是否成功。如果正确配置,日志文件应该显示JVM的初始内存和最大内存大小。
总结:
通过本文的介绍,我们了解了如何修改Tomcat的内存配置。通过适当地配置Tomcat的内存大小,我们可以优化服务器的性能和稳定性。但是需要注意的是,修改Tomcat的内存配置可能会影响服务器的整体性能,请确保按照服务器的需求进行适当的配置。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;3.作者投稿可能会经我们编辑修改或补充。